"Hades” in the Contemporary Greek World

Question: If the translators of the Septuagint considered that “Hades” was a fair representation of the Hebrew word “Sheol,” is it true, in view of the universal application of “Hades” in the contemporary Greek world, to means “the grave”?

Answer: It is of course admitted that the Septuagint translation of the O.T. (the LXX.) invariably renders Sheol by the Greek word Hades. It is also true that Sheol in the O.T. is rendered Hades in the N.T. in citations from the O.T., as in Acts 2:27 and 31. In the Authorised Version of the English Bible (the A.V.) Sheol is rendered hell, grave and pit more or less indiscriminately; hell and grave 31 times in each case, and pit 3 times. The revisers have on the whole done well in indicating, in either the text or the margin, every occurrence of Sheol in the Hebrew. This does at least put the ordinary reader in possession of the facts so thoroughly hidden in the A.V.; but the revisers have themselves been guilty of some degree of unfairness in stating, in their Preface, that “Sheol signifies the abode of departed spirits.” Their marginal note to Genesis 37:35 is, however, accurate and fair: “Heb. Sheol, the name of the abode of the dead, answering to the Greek Hades, Acts 2:27.”
